🌾 What Is Thaalippu Vadagam?

Thaalippu Vadagam (also called seasoning vadagam or fryum) is a traditional Tamil tempering mix made by coarsely grinding small onions, garlic, lentils, mustard seeds, fenugreek seeds, dried red chilies, curry leaves, and asafoetida. These ingredients are shaped into small balls or clusters and sun-dried for several days.

Once dried, the vadagam can be stored for months and used as a one-step tempering solution. When added to hot oil, it sizzles and releases a burst of flavor that forms the base of many South Indian dishes.

🧑‍🍳 How to Use

Basic Tempering Method

  1. Heat 1–2 tsp oil or ghee in a pan
  2. Add 1–2 pieces of Thulasi Vadagam
  3. Sauté until golden and aromatic
  4. Add vegetables, dal, or tamarind base and continue cooking

🌍 Cultural Significance

Thaalippu Vadagam is a staple in Tamil kitchens, especially in rural households and temple cooking. It’s often prepared in summer and stored for year-round use. The process of making vadagam is a family tradition, passed down through generations, and reflects the Tamil values of sustainability, simplicity, and flavor.
